Is there a relation between police protection and fire protection? A random sample of large population areas gave the following information about the number of local police and the number of local fire-fighters (units in thousands). (Reference: Statistical Abstract of the United States.) Use a 5% level of significance to test the claim that there is a monotone relationship (either way) between the ranks of number of police and number of firefighters. (a) Rank-order police using 1 as the largest data value. Also rank-order firefighters using 1 as the largest data value. Then construct a table of ranks to be used for a Spearman rank correlation test. (c) Compute the sample test statistic. (Use 3 decimal places.) Area 1 2 3 4 5 6 7 8 9 10 11 12 13 Police 5.3 13.3 16.2 11.3 8.0 12.7 11.7 1.9 14.6 6.8 11.0 10.3 7.3 Firefighters 0.8 5.1 5.2 3.2 2.8 3.0 4.1 1.3 5.4 2.4 4.8 3.3 3.7
